Introduction of Ms. Bui Thi Minh Hoai as candidate for the 16th National Assembly

Ms. Bui Thi Minh Hoai, Politburo member, Secretary of the Party Central Committee, and President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front, has been nominated as a candidate for the 16th National Assembly.

On 13/1, the Agency of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front organized a conference to gather opinions from voters at the workplace regarding individuals expected to be nominated as candidates for the 16th National Assembly.

Besides Ms. Bui Thi Minh Hoai, other nominated personnel include Ha Thi Nga, Vice President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front, and Nguyen Thai Hoc, Deputy Secretary of the Party Committee of the Fatherland Front and central mass organizations.

Two Heads of Departments from the Agency of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front were allocated and nominated by the National Assembly Standing Committee as full-time deputies for the 16th National Assembly: Vu Van Tien, Head of the Propaganda Department, and Nguyen Quynh Lien, Head of the Democracy, Supervision, and Social Criticism Department.

After hearing the brief biographies of the candidates, voters commented that the nominees possess strong political qualities, have good work capacity, and meet the required qualifications for the 16th National Assembly candidacy. The conference saw 100% of voters unanimously vote to nominate these individuals.

Ms. Bui Thi Minh Hoai, Politburo member, Secretary of the Party Central Committee, President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front. *Photo: Giang Huy*

On behalf of the nominated individuals, Vice President Ha Thi Nga expressed gratitude for the attention and trust shown by leaders of the Party Committee and the Agency of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front. She committed to fulfilling the duty of representing and protecting the legitimate rights and interests of all strata of the people, and participating in building the Party, the State, and the political system.

She stressed that they would perform social supervision and criticism tasks as regulated, participate in deciding important national issues, and that each deputy would serve as a bridge between the Party, the State, and the people.
